UNESCO experts meeting in Florence, Italy, in the early 1950s adopted the terms of
an international agreement to promote international understanding and peace by
lowering barriers to the exchange of cultural, scientific and educational materials,
most importantly by waiving tariffs on such materials. The agreement covers diverse
categories: books and other printed materials, art and museum pieces, tourism
materials, audiovisual materials and the like. Annex D of the agreement covered
scientific instruments and apparatus.

Paragraph (b)(2) also provides that an applicant must apply to receive all business
proprietary information on the record of the particular segment of the proceeding in
question. The purposes of this requirement are to eliminate the need for parties to prepare
separate APO versions of submissions for each of the different parties involved in a
proceeding and to reduce the number of APO violations that occur through the
inadvertent service of a document containing business proprietary information to parties
not authorized to receive it. In order to avoid forcing parties to receive a submission in
which they have no interest, however, a party may waive service of business proprietary
information it does not wish to have served on it by another party.
